Definitions:

Journal

A record where all financial transactions are initially noted before being transferred to specific accounts in the ledger.

Income Statement Columns

Income statement columns refer to the structured format used to present the revenues, expenses, and net profit or loss of a business over a specific period.

Income Statement

A financial statement that shows a company's revenues and expenses over a specific period, culminating in net income or loss.

Net Income

The final earnings of a company after total revenue has had all taxes and expenses removed.
